| Feature | Clematis | Dendrobium Orchid |
|---|---|---|
| Scientific Name | Clematis spp. | Dendrobium spp. |
| Family | Ranunculaceae | Orchidaceae |
| Category | vines | flowers |
| Sun | ☀️ Full Sun | ⛅ Part Shade |
| Water | 💧💧 Medium | 💧 Low |
| Soil | Rich, Well-drained | Orchid bark mix |
| Height | 20' | 2' |
| Spread | 3' | 8" |
| Bloom Season | Spring-Fall | Spring |
| Bloom Color | Purple, Blue, Pink, White | White, Purple, Yellow |
| Growth Rate | Medium | Medium |
| Native Region | Northern Hemisphere | Asia, Australia |
| Maintenance | Medium | Medium |

Choose Clematis if you don't mind medium maintenance, and want deer resistance. It thrives in full sun with medium water in zones 4–9.
Choose Dendrobium Orchid if you don't mind medium maintenance, and want deer resistance. It thrives in part shade with low water in zones 9–12.
Plant them together? Both overlap in zones 9–9. However, they have different sun needs, so plan your garden layout carefully.
